Transaction 76ec740898ef0667c414de21f4682adc8dfb49478880501a6f0b4e128f062a7e
1 Input
1 Output
-
76ec740898ef0667c414de21f4682adc8dfb49478880501a6f0b4e128f062a7e:0
- value
- 950096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81ac82f9a99301a523293147ede8ec7353a5c628 OP_EQUAL
- address
- 3DWfkcBvXhKuxx9K4B8bF1pojmSLFMBSBc